The Mechanics of Connecting a Portable Generator to Your Home

Before we dive into the step-by-step guide, it’s essential to understand the mechanics of connecting a portable generator to your home. The process involves several key components, including the generator, transfer switch, and electrical panel.

A portable generator produces electricity through a process called fuel-based power generation. The generator is typically fueled by gasoline, diesel, or propane, depending on the model and intended use. The electrical output is then transmitted to a transfer switch, which acts as a safety switch that allows you to safely transfer power from the grid to the generator and back again.

Step 1: Choose the Right Generator for Your Needs

The first step in connecting a portable generator to your home is to choose the right generator for your needs. This depends on several factors, including the size of your house, the number of appliances you want to power, and your energy requirements.

Consider the following factors when selecting a portable generator:

  • Wattage: Determine the total wattage required to power your appliances, including the refrigerator, television, and lights.
  • Runtime: Calculate the runtime of the generator based on the fuel capacity and usage.
  • Noise Level: Consider the noise level of the generator if you plan to use it for extended periods.
  • Certifications: Look for certifications such as UL and CSA to ensure the generator meets safety standards.
